Output 9354801c84c0682f06a9d3b633eb858a4d6ba9e97866ce52efba2d07bba36c68:1

value
990160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1445de0cf5f53807e3b569b6427d1fa7e27f156f OP_EQUALVERIFY OP_CHECKSIG
address
12rCDJquVx1KqpETXSxyM58HyC3mu4M6d7
transaction
9354801c84c0682f06a9d3b633eb858a4d6ba9e97866ce52efba2d07bba36c68
spent
true